    How long is my pre-approval for an auto loan valid?

    Your pre-approval from Landmark is valid for 60 days. Please note that a pre-approval is not an offer to lend, a commitment for a loan or a guarantee of specific rates or terms.

    Can I get pre-approved before buying a home?

    Yes, we recommend that you get pre-approved for a mortgage before beginning your home search. A pre-approval will provide you with more specific information about the amount that you qualify to borrow. The seller and real estate agents involved in the transaction may require a pre-approval letter at the time you make an offer.
